The GeForce GTX 1660 SUPER handles Roles & Dice well at 1080p, delivering approximately 102 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 77 FPS.

About

To enjoy a smooth experience in this online virtual tabletop RPG, an entry-level G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T is sufficient for minimum requirements. This game is designed to be accessible, allowing players with modest hardware to engage in its immersive worlds and strategic gameplay. For optimal performance, especially if you want to explore creative map features and engage in real-time interactions, a mid-range GPU such as the GTX 1660 or RX 6600 will provide a noticeable boost, enabling higher settings at 1080p.

For players with more powerful setups, targeting 1440p at high settings is achievable with GPUs like the RTX 3060 or RX 6700 XT. The game is not particularly demanding, making it a great choice for those who want to enjoy a rich tabletop experience without needing top-tier hardware.
